在如今的数字时代,小程序作为应用程序的新形态,已经成为了众多企业和开发者的热门选择。本文将为您提供一份关于小程序搭建的全面指南,帮助您从基础知识到实际操作,深入了解如何高效搭建小程序。
1. 小程序的基本概念
小程序是一种不需要下载安装即可使用的应用,它实现了应用的“即用即走”模式。相较于传统应用,小程序的优势在于更快的加载速度和更少的存储空间需求。
小程序通常在移动设备中使用,并通过二维码和分享等方式进行传播。为了让您更好地理解小程序的概念,我们可以从以下几个方面入手:
1.1 小程序的特点
小程序有几个显著的特点,例如:
- 运行快:小程序无需下载,打开即用。
- 更新便捷:开发者可以随时更新,用户自动获取最新版本。
- 轻量化:所需的存储空间极小。
2. 小程序的搭建流程
搭建小程序主要分为几个步骤,下面将详细介绍每一个步骤,确保您能够顺利搭建自己的小程序。

2.1 注册开发者账号
在开始之前,首要任务是要注册一个开发者账号。您可以选择去相关平台进行注册,如微信、支付宝等。注册步骤包括:
1. 访问相应的小程序官网。
2. 点击注册按钮,填写个人信息。
3. 完成邮箱验证和身份认证。
2.2 创建小程序项目
一旦注册成功,您就可以创建小程序项目。我们以微信小程序为例,创建步骤如下:
1. 登录开发者后台。
2. 点击“创建小程序”按钮。
3. 填写小程序基本信息,如名称、描述等。
3. 小程序的开发环境搭建
在创建项目后,您需要搭建开发环境来进行代码编写。这包括安装必要的开发工具和配置工程文件。
3.1 安装开发工具
对于微信小程序,您需要下载和安装微信开发者工具。安装过程一般如下:
1. 访问微信官网进行下载。
2. 完成安装并启动工具。
3. 登陆开发者账号。
3.2 配置项目文件
安装好工具后,您需要为新建的项目配置一些文件,确保开发环境正常工作。这些配置包括:
1. app.json: 配置小程序相关设置。
2. app.js: 小程序的主逻辑文件。
3. page文件夹: 存放具体页面的代码。
4. 小程序的功能实现
通过小程序,开发者可以实现丰富的功能,如交互、数据展示等。在这一部分,您将了解到如何实现基本的功能。
4.1 页面布局与样式
小程序的页面布局主要依赖于WXML和WXSS。在页面中,您可以自定义组件和样式,以下是一个简单的布局示例:
欢迎使用小程序
/* index.wxss */
.container {padding: 20px;background-color: #f8f8f8;
}
4.2 交互功能的实现
实现交互功能是小程序的一大亮点,开发者可以使用事件绑定功能为用户提供更好的体验。以下是一个简单的交互示例代码:
// index.js
Page({onClick: function() {wx.showToast({title: '按钮被点击',icon: 'none'});}
});
5. 小程序的发布与维护
在完成开发后,您需要发布小程序并进行后续维护,以确保小程序持续正常运行。
5.1 提交审核
在发布小程序前,需要经过平台审核。审核内容包括但不限于内容合法性、功能实现等。提交审核的步骤如下:
1. 登录开发者后台。
2. 选择“上传代码”。
3. 提交审核申请。
5.2 后台数据监控
发布后,您可以通过后台监控小程序的使用情况。数据分析功能将帮助您了解用户行为,以便进行后续的优化和调整。
通过本篇文章的介绍,您应该对小程序的搭建有了更全面的理解。从基础概念到具体的实践步骤,逐步领会,您也能搭建出符合您需求的小程序。希望本文能够为您的开发之旅提供帮助!


